I'd decided this was a cabaret but am now not sure after seeing recent photos of mealy. Am interested to hear other peoples opinion. Sorry the images aren't that good but the bird was only present for less than a minute before flying off.
The wing bars were pure white with no buff, I did not see the utc's, the rest I think you can make out in the pictures.

Difficult to be 100% certain from the photos, but the greyish looking face/neck sides, pale rump, and whitish wingbars all suggest a (smart male) Mealy.
